On 10/27/2010 01:21 PM, Ying Han wrote:
> kswapd's use case of hardware PTE accessed bit is to approximate page LRU. The
> ActiveLRU demotion to InactiveLRU are not base on accessed bit, while it is only
> used to promote when a page is on inactive LRU list. All of the state transitions
> are triggered by memory pressure and thus has weak relationship with respect to
> time. In addition, hardware already transparently flush tlb whenever CPU context
> switch processes and given limited hardware TLB resource, the time period in
> which a page is accessed but not yet propagated to struct page is very small
> in practice. With the nature of approximation, kernel really don't need to flush TLB
> for changing PTE's access bit. This commit removes the flush operation from it.

The reasoning behind the patch makes sense.
However, have you measured any improvements in run time with
this patch? The VM is already tweaked to minimize the number
of pages that get aged, so it would be interesting to know
where you saw issues.
